The History of Thoroughbred Horse Breeding in South Africa

The foundation of thoroughbred breeding in South Africa can be traced back to the early 1800s, when the first imported horses arrived at the Cape of Good Hope. Over the years, thoroughbreds have been bred for their speed, agility, and stamina. Today, South Africa has a well-established reputation as a producer of top-quality thoroughbred horses, with the Orkney region leading the charge.

In recent years, South African thoroughbred breeders have also focused on breeding horses with strong immune systems and resistance to diseases such as African Horse Sickness. This has become increasingly important due to the outbreak of the disease in the country, which has had a devastating impact on the equine industry. By breeding horses with natural resistance to the disease, breeders hope to create a more resilient population of thoroughbreds in South Africa.

The Care and Feeding of Thoroughbred Horses: A Behind-the-Scenes Look

Thoroughbred horses require meticulous care and attention to maintain their health and well-being. From the quality of their feed to the regularity of their exercise routines, every aspect of their care is carefully monitored to ensure optimal health and performance. A behind-the-scenes look at the day-to-day care of these majestic animals reveals just how much work and dedication goes into raising thoroughbred horses.

One of the most important aspects of caring for thoroughbred horses is their living conditions. These horses require spacious and well-ventilated stables, with clean bedding and regular cleaning to prevent the spread of disease. Additionally, they need access to fresh water at all times and should be turned out to pasture regularly to allow for exercise and socialization with other horses. All of these factors contribute to the overall health and happiness of the horses, and are essential for their success on the racetrack.
